Coordinator of Athletic Parking Operations
Louisiana State University
Coordinator of Athletic Parking Operations Athletics Louisiana State University 40% Oversees the management/coordination of parking and traffic operations for LSU athletics events and events hosted in athletics venues - according to University Policies and procedures. Serves as liaison for parking related functions and will be expected to communicate with athletic department regarding operational activities. 20% Oversees event preparation including but not limited to: staffing of parking lots, monitoring areas, maintenance of parking lots utilized for athletic events, ensuring lots are setup, security of lots and enforcement of policies and procedures. Duties include oversight and supervision of the hiring, scheduling, and training of approximately 200 contracted gameday workers - which include parking lot attendants, student workers, gameday guest service ambassadors, security guards, and law enforcement personnel. Supervise up to 10 student workers and volunteer staff. 15% Coordination of multiple agencies in the preparation for Athletic Events. Fosters a relationship with other University personnel, Office of Parking and Transportation, Facility Services, Campus Police, Finance and Administrative Services, Student Government, LSU Alumni Association, Baton Rouge City Police, East Baton Rouge Sheriff, Capital Area Transit, and State Police. Creates and provides materials for all staff on gamedays and communications with all groups regarding unique gameday elements. 10% Proposes, modifies and implements parking and tailgating policies and procedures for the Athletic Department, including updating fan material and maintain database with historical information. Ensures compliance with Americans with Disabilities Act in regards to athletic parking events and compliance with all NCAA rules regarding distribution of player (athlete) complimentary parking. Establishes, maintains, and fulfills the control methods for cash handling and systems utilized on gamedays - such as permit scanners. 10% Updates bids and proposals to ensure adequate staffing and equipment needs for all LSU Athletics Events. Develops, maintains, and provides recommendations for repairs, improvements with equipment and protocols. Plans and prepares documents for customer service best practices, including training and educational material for hired lot attendants. Oversees and develops guidelines for approximately 20 gameday guest service ambassadors. 5% Other duties as assigned. Minimum Qualifications: Bachelor's degree with one year of experience in event management or related field. Knowledge of Microsoft Office. Valid Driver's license. Preferred Qualifications: Master's degree with two years experience in event management and operations. Experience with event parking operations at a Division I-A Athletic Department and familiar management procedures at large scale events. Ability to multi-task and demonstration of project management skills. Special or Physical Qualifications: Ability to work extended hours, days, weekends and holidays. Ability to stand, walk, and lift objects up to 50 lbs.
